Autologica presents the fifth part in a series of articles that address some of the common problems and situations that arise in family-owned businesses. The articles are based on an interview between Al McClymont, CEO of Autologica Dealer Management Systems, and J. C. Aimetta, an expert and coach who specializes in family-owned businesses and who has ample experience consulting for this type of company.

Al McClymont: Regarding the succession issue in a family-owned business, specifically the election of the successor, isn’t it possible that this can cause problems if someone feels excluded?

J. C. Aimetta: Well, at first glance I’d say yes, generally a solution brings with it a new problem.

The truth is that you can decide which problem to have: This one that will be generated right now, or the one that will be created in the future of a small company trying to be co-managed by three or four people, with the respective power struggle and the growth of internal bands among employees who are faithful to one or the other.

And another point is that the evaluation generally begins with oneself, with each family member in particular. Then, you can ask each family member: Do you feel qualified to work in the family business?

And it is in these meetings that one discovers that many sons and daughters admit that their life project is not related to the family business, but rather that they are safeguarding their father’s dream, and that when their father dies, they will probably choose to do what they always wanted to do.

If succession is presented as a competition, this never comes to light. But , if you present it as a personal, intimate question, liberating the person from the obligation of continuing with the business role, for it was not he/she who made the decision but the father, it is very likely that at least one or two of the people competing for power will spontaneously separate themselves or accept minor roles because they do not feel this is for them.

Al McClymont: What happens if the chosen successor is offered a better opportunity outside the company?

J. C. Aimetta: First of all, if the family business is managed as a business and not as a family, it should be expected that replacements are planned for.

Children are irreplaceable in a family; nobody brings a child into this world to replace another one.

But in a company, a manager can be replaced by someone else. If these two environments can be differentiated, this would be the most suitable recipe.

However , this is not common. When someone listens to a job offer outside the family business, we can assume that the opportunity represents something better than what they currently have.

It is very common that this extra benefit is not financial, but that instead it signifies an absence of problems, of displeasure.

That is to say, those who accept to manage what is not theirs instead of managing what is theirs, do this in order to free themselves from the stress and tension generated by the constant conflicts of the family.

Note how interesting this is, because this person leaves management but stays on as an owner. In other words, this person decides to dedicate their talent to administer something that is not theirs, and chooses someone else to manage what is theirs.

This is not the same as someone who abandons ownership, who sells their share… this family member abandons the job but retains ownership.

Most likely they have lost interest.

Another reason they may lose interest is simply that the pay is too low. Thus, they think to themselves, “I am earning 10 here, and I will earn 25 there. But , apart from the 10 I am earning here, I am making this company grow. This company has grown 80% in the last few years. And I am keeping 1/4 or 1/3 of the increase in family patrimony (according to the number of siblings). This is not in my best interest. ”

How to Avoid Spamming Your Customers

One thing an e-business must take very seriously is SPAM. No one likes to receive it, and more and more consumers are sick of it and taking action. Some businesses have even been fined, sued and in some instances, jail time has been recommended.

Far too often, email correspondence from businesses is taken as SPAM, when in actuality; it is a simple email promoting a new product to an existing customer. How can your e-business avoid falling into this trap?

Here are some pointers to make sure you are never accused of sending SPAM.

Tip #1 – The Double Opt-In Mailing List

If you plan to run an e-zine, keep in touch with your customers and collect email addresses on the Internet, you are definitely going to have to utilize Double Opt-In mailing list rules. What this means is that when a customer signs up for your mailing list, they will be sent an email to confirm their subscription. The customer cannot receive your mailing without replying to the confirmation email. It is a very simple step, but one that will save you countless trouble later on. Most mailing list programs keep a log of all subscriptions and responses to the confirmation email, leaving you with important proof that the email a consumer is receiving was asked for.

Tip #2 – Keep a Regular Schedule

If you do send out an e-zine or notifications of new products, make sure you keep the emails to a regular schedule. Let your subscribers know in advance when the email will be sent out and how often you plan to send it. This will cut down on SPAM complaints if everyone knows the schedule in advance. Once you have set a schedule – stick to it! If you don’t have a set schedule, you may want to let your customers know that emails will come periodically, but not in an overabundance.

Tip #3 – Avoiding SPAM Filters

One way to quickly have your email categorized as SPAM is by using words in the email that will automatically send it to the junk mail folder and in some instances, get your company reported as a SPAMMER. It is not easy to avoid all of the commonly used words, but it will save you time and effort if you check the current lists of commonly filtered words and steer clear of using them in the subject line and body of your email.

Tip #4 – Buying Mailing Lists – Do Your Research

When looking for new customers, one of the most common methods is purchasing an existing mailing list. Several companies compile customer information and sell them to the highest bidder. While you may be getting several million new leads, you could also be getting several million new complaints. If you do decide to purchase a mailing list, make sure that the information you are buying was collected using double opt-in.

Tip #5 – Presentation Matters

When you do send out customer emails, make sure that they look professional, and that they give the best possible impression of your company. You don’t have to spend a lot of money making it look pretty, but it is important that you put your best foot forward. How many SPAM’s have you received that were formatted strangely, contained key words that didn’t belong and where pretty much a mess to look at? You can stand out from the crowd if your presentation and methods are professional.

Tip #6 – Choosing the Right Service Provider

When you set up your mailing list with a third party, make sure that the company will not use your customer’s addresses and turn around and sell them. Many customers who do sign up for e-zines and product notifications don’t give out their email addresses to just anyone. It is very easy to be accused of selling information when it was the company hosting your list that is to blame.

When you do collect customer information, it is always a good idea to put yourself in their shoes. Would you want your information sold to the highest bidder? Do you receive too many emails from the same company and get so sick of it you automatically hit the delete key? Keep in mind these things when you do contact your customers.

Choosing Domain Names - Hyphens or Not?


Choosing a good domain name is one of most important steps in setting up your online business, but it’s getting harder and harder to find good names that are still available. You could use a domain name with hyphens, but is that really a good idea?

Let’s quickly review what makes a good domain name. A domain name needs to be relevant, easy to remember, keyword optimized, and free from trademark conflicts. It should also be shorter. Although seven characters or less is ideal, you may have to settle for a domain name that’s a little longer.

So you’ve just set up your new barbecue grills business and now you discover that barbecuegrills. com is already taken. Should you consider hyphenating the domain name to barbecue-grills. com or should you go back to the drawing board?

The first choice should always be to take the name without a hyphen. Having established that, there are some exceptions. Let’s look at hyphenated domain names and when they are might be good to use.

domains with hyphens can sometimes be a good idea if you really want certain words in your domain name but all the domains without hyphens are already taken.

Another reason to use a hyphen is when the words you plan to use are harder to read without the hyphen. The domain hotellamps. com is harder to read than hotel-lamps. com. That is not necessarily a great domain name but it does serve to illustrate the point that some domains are easier to read with a hyphen.

You might also consider using hyphens for search engine optimization. Some people suggest that using hyphens helps the search engines to distinguish your keywords better. This may be a good option for webmasters whose primary goal is to optimize their sites for traffic from natural search engine rankings. The only catch here is that this could change over time since search engines are constantly adjusting their search algorithms.

Incidentally, if you decide not to use hyphens in your domain name, watch out for any unintended double meanings that might be embarrassing. To illustrate this point a couple of fairly suspicious domain names are therapistfinder. com and molestationnursery. com. In case you are wondering the latter was reportedly the domain for the Mole Station Native Nursery based in New South Wales, Australia, although it seems, fortunately, to have moved.

Whatever reason you have for using a hyphen in your domain name, it would be good to remember one thing. Some people will forget the hyphen when they type your domain name. So whenever you invest in promoting your site, some lucky webmaster who owns the un-hyphenated version of your domain is going to get some free traffic, courtesy of your hard work.

As you can see, there are some situations when using a hyphen in your domain name may be a good decision.

How Do I Get My Business On The Internet?


This is one of the most frequently asked questions by small business owners. They are feeling the pressure from their customers and competitors, yet for many business people it is a daunting task, as they don't understand the whole process.

In fact , many people are even asking the question whether they should have a website. Whether you are a consultant, florist, designer, builder, architect or a doctor, consider the many advantages a website provides:

1 . Make money - Set up an on-line store or get paid for advertising from other companies

2 . Save money on advertising - Instead of paying for large ads, simply advertise your website

3. Be flexible in your message - Change the content as your business changes. No need to re-print expensive brochures.

4. Exposure to new customers - You will reach more local clients as well as interstate and global markets

5. Having more professional image - Keep up with the times and your competitors

6. Save time - Don’t spend hours on the phone, direct customers to your website

7. Keep your business open 24/7 - Provide customers information when THEY need it. If you don’t, someone else will.

So what does it really take to get your website set up?

Step 1 - Register your domain name OR not.

The big question is whether you need to register a domain name or not. The simple answer is NO, but a better answer is YES it is a good idea.

What is a domain name?

The purpose of a domain name is similar to that of a street address or telephone number. The domain name directs customers to you on the Internet. The domain by itself is not your email or web address. The domain does form the base from which these addresses are derived.

For example: Company Name: QikPhone Domain Name: qikphone. com. au Web Address: www.qikphone.com.au Email Address: sales@qikphone. com

Do I need to register a domain name to have a website?

NO, you don't need to have your own domain name. Your website can be created and hosted without it. Your website address will look something like this: www.web4business.com.au/JBCleaning OR www.ozemail.com.au/~JBCleaning

The only advantage of not registering a domain name is that you will save yourself a few dollars.

The disadvantages of NOT having your domain name include:

1 . If you decide to change your Webhosting company or if that company goes out of business, you will lose your website address. Your website can be transferred to a new company, but your address will change. And that means re-printing stationery and re-doing all your advertising, notifying all your customers etc .

2 . Website addresses that contain information other than your company name are long and hard to remember and do not appear as professional. Compare these two and see which one you are more likely to remember: www.ozemail.com.au/~JBCleaning OR www.JBCleaning.com.au

So it is a good idea to register a domain name, even if it is just to protect yourself for the future. Say for example , your business name is JB Cleaning and you decide not to register your domain name for now. Along comes Joe Bloggs who opens his own cleaning business and registers JBCleaning. com. au domain name. After a year you decide you want to have your own domain name, but since Joe Bloggs already owns it, you won't be able to register it. Not to mention your customers who know your business as JB Cleaning may visit his website, thinking it's your web address and instead hire Joe Bloggs Cleaning.

How to Successfully Promote your Business to an International Audience

Breaking into the international marketplace can catapult a company into increased profitability and growth more rapidly than when selling to a domestic market.

But how do you market your company successfully to overseas buyers? What can you do to provide the right information to prospective clients that is informative and engaging? How can you stand out from the crowd?

The most common promotional approach is to provide brochures. While brochures do play an important role, they can be uninspiring and ill equipped to convey a real feeling for what an organisation does and how they operate.

Furthermore, when brochures are translated into other languages it is commonly agreed that even the best translations are cumbersome and not reflective of how that particular language is used. This often means that international prospects feel less inclined to read brochures in depth.

So how do you show prospective clients how your product is made? What can you do to highlight your product range and its associated benefits?

A proven promotional method is corporate video production. The combination of moving vision with sound, allows complex messages to be communicated in a far superior way to that of any written information.

Research has found that video can be up to four times more effective than a printed brochure. Given that 80% of the information we recall is visual, it is understandable why audiovisual materials are so successful in getting messages across to viewers.

The best investment companies can make is by providing prospective clients with their corporate video on a VHS tape or a menu driven dvd disk or CDROM disk (which is like the menu option on a movie dvd).

CDROMs are particularly flexible as they can include video, brochures, documents and website links. They can even be produced as CD business cards which is perfect for travellers who wish to reduce the amount of marketing materials they need to carry.

Corporate videos can be downloaded from websites, which not only saves money in distribution costs, but provides 24 hour worldwide access.

A further advantage of corporate video is that it allows for voiceovers to be translated into a variety of languages. As visual cues are used in conjunction with the voiceover, the language sounds natural and appealing.

The winner of the 2002 Regional Exporter of the Year Awards, the Warrnambool Cheese and Butter Factory, strongly agrees with the use of corporate video production to boost export sales.

John Williams, Warrnambool Cheese and Butter Factory’s marketing manager, says “We are very proud of our Factory and our picturesque location. It makes a lot of sense to show our best attributes to their advantage and the way to do that is through a corporate video. ”

“We’ve found corporate video to be extremely flexible. I can travel overseas and show a dvd quality video to potential clients on my notebook computer”.

“We had a short promotional video created that was slotted into our Powerpoint presentation which we presented to a large Japanese dairy importer. It really gave us the competitive edge and helped us win a large multi-million dollar contract”.

Justin Howden, an International Marketing specialist from Marketing and Investment Partners, also advocates using corporate videos when marketing overseas.

“For companies that are undertaking trade marketing, corporate video is critical. It is vital to get trade onside when marketing overseas and corporate video is irreplaceable when trying to get distributors involved, ” he says.

“A successful corporate video is created by finding out what are the most important pieces of information that your target market wants to know. You need to unearth what 20% of information will give you an 80% kick in marketing terms. Once you’ve done this, you then need to focus on these important points in the promotional video”.

Corporate video production is a powerful, convenient and cost effective way for overseas buyers to see what you have to offer. It is an innovative method that can encompass video, brochures, documents and website/email links into one small CD business card.

By using a combination of the right promotional tools and a creative approach, the time-consuming and often difficult road to breaking into the global marketplace, can be made much easier.
